Care for Your 180-ah lifepo4 battery.

Caring for your 180-ah lifepo4 battery is essential for maximizing lifespan and performance. Start by ensuring it’s installed in a well-ventilated area to prevent overheating.

Check the battery terminals regularly for corrosion or dirt buildup, as these can impede electrical flow. A clean connection enhances efficiency.

Monitor the charge levels frequently. Keeping your battery between 20% and 80% charged promotes longevity. Avoid deep discharges that could strain the cells.

Temperatures plays a significant role too—ideally, keep it in environments ranging from 32°F to 113°F (0°C to 45°C). Extreme temperatures can lead to reduced capacity or damage.

Invest in a quality Battery Management System (BMS). This device protects against overcharging and short circuits, ensuring safe operation for years.

Specifications of lifepo4 battery

When considering a 180-ah lifepo4 battery, specifications are crucial in determining its suitability for your off-grid needs.

These batteries typically have a nominal voltage of 12.8V or similar configurations, making them compatible with most solar setups and inverters. Their capacity to deliver high discharge rates ensures that they can power multiple appliances simultaneously without significant performance drops.

Weight is another critical specification; these batteries generally weigh between 40 and 50 pounds. Their weight allows for easier installation compared to traditional lead-acid options.

Safety features are also essential. Look for built-in Battery Management Systems (BMS) that prevent overcharging and overheating, enhancing longevity and reliability.

Consider the cycle life—most quality Lifepo4 batteries offer up to 3000 charge-discharge cycles at full depth of discharge. This durability translates into long-term savings and peace of mind when living off the grid.

Factors to consider when choosing lifepo4 battery

When selecting a 180-ah lifepo4 battery, start by evaluating the depth of discharge (DoD). This metric indicates how much energy can be safely used without damaging the battery. A higher DoD allows for more usable power.

Next, consider the battery’s cycle life. Lifepo4 batteries are known for longevity, but not all models offer the same charge and discharge cycles. Look for options with at least 2000 cycles to ensure durability.

Weight and size also matter. Ensure that your setup has adequate space while considering portability if needed.

Check compatibility with your existing solar or backup systems. Some batteries work better with specific inverter setups or charging methods.

Review warranty and customer support offerings from manufacturers; strong backing gives peace of mind on your investment.
